2.4.3
Hand switch Memory
Electrical connection
Plug DIN 45329
Cable length: 1.7 m (67’’)
Supply voltage
5 VDC ± 10 %
Power consumption (average)
50 mA
Protection class (DIN EN 60529)
IP 30

Lifting column SL, SK oder SM
Duty cycle 2/18; operating max. 2 min, pause 18 min
NOTE
The lifting system can be subjected to uneven loads as long …
→
the max. load on the single lifting element is not exceeded,
→
the max. bending torque of the lifting element is not exceeded,
→
the entire system is located on sufficient safe ground
… and the entire plant has been constructed in accordance with the provisions of the mechan-
ical equilibrium.
Conducting a risk analysis
ATTENTION
High pulse / impact forces due to the discontinuation of loads are not allowed.
(e.g. discontinuation of loads in feed with crane or forklift)
